This contract involves the procurement of two units of an inverter drive identified under NSN/Part Number 7310-01-583-1448, with a delivery requirement of 20 days after order acceptance. The solicitation number for the contract is SPE3SE-26-T-0788, posted by the Department of Defense's Subsistence FSE Supply Chain and managed through the Defense Logistics Agency. The contract incorporates specific technical and quality requirements as detailed in the DLA Master List, with applicable revisions determined by the solicitation or award dates. Packaging and removal of government identification from non-accepted items must comply with stated DLA requirements. Notably, the contract restricts mercury or mercury-containing compounds from being intentionally included or in direct contact with any hardware or supplies, except in certain specified functions such as batteries, sensors, or weapon systems, conforming to NAVSEA standards. There is no requirement for Class I ozone-depleting substances to be used, and no current approved technical data package is available for this NSN within the DLA Troop Support sector. MERCURY OR MERCURY CONTAINING COMPOUNDS SHALL
NOT BE INTENTIONALLY ADDED TO<(>,<)> OR COME IN DIRECT
CONTACT WITH<(>,<)> ANY HARDWARE OR SUPPLIES FURNISHED
UNDER THIS CONTRACT. EXCEPTION: FUNCTIONAL MERCURY
USED IN BATTERIES, FLUORESCENT LIGHTS, REQUIRED
INSTRUMENTS; SENSORS OR CONTROLS; WEAPON SYSTEMS;
AND CHEMICAL ANALYSIS REAGENTS SPECIFIED BY NAVSEA.
PORTABLE FLUORESCENT LAMPS AND PORTABLE INSTRUMENTS
CONTAINING MERCURY SHALL BE SHOCK PROOF AND CONTAIN
A SECOND BOUNDARY OF CONTAINMENT OF THE MERCURY OR
MERCURY COMPOUND. (IAW NAVSEA 5100-003D).
